Item description

The Hanwag Tatra Light Wide GTX is a pleasantly light and comfortable walking boot with an ergonomic design and a wider fit with a wider forefoot. The core of this hiking boot is the stable lightweight sole. This is due to the special profile design and Hanwag 3D PrismBase technology. As a result, the walking boot has a new Hanwag Integral Light sole. This lower sole improves stability and retains perfect cushioning. The hiking boot also has an upper of suede and polyamide with a lining of Gore-Tex, which makes the hiking boot waterproof and ensures good breathability. The walking boot is in category B for walking shoes.

HANWAG makes use of specific shoe fittings, for example a Narrow fit, Wide fit, or Bunion fit. If a HANWAG shoe has been designed with a special fit, this is mentioned in the product title / description. If there is no mention of a specific type of fit, then you can assume that the shoe in question has a standard / average fit. HANWAG Narrow fit is suitable for those with a smaller foot width, HANWAG Wide fit is suitable for those with a larger foot width, and HANWAG Bunion fit is suitable for people whose big toe is crooked and bends towards their other toes (Hallux Valgus). When trekking and hiking, it's of vital importance that your footwear fits properly and comfortably. Your heel needs to sit securely in the back and your toes need to have enough room in the front. You can test this by putting the shoes on without tying up the laces. If it seems that there is a bit too much room at the sides or that it's a bit loose, then the heel is too wide for your feet. A top tip for checking if a shoe is the right size for you is seeing whether there is enough space for you to fit your finger between the tip of the shoe and your toes. If there is not enough space, then the shoe is too large; it's important to have this space so as to prevent your toes hitting the shoe when walking downhill.

Category B

These boots provide excellent support and can therefore be used for multi-day hikes. The trecking or hiking boots have a sole that is more rigid than in Category A and the shoes also feature a higher shaft, providing better support to the ankles. The hiking boots are suitable for mountainous terrains, but for the real mountains, the sole is too lenient.
